Make-Ahead Strawberry French Toast Casserole
Whether for Christmas morning or a brunch gathering with friends, this Make-Ahead Strawberry French Toast Casserole is a deliciously simple make-ahead breakfast casserole. Prepare this company French toast casserole the day before, refrigerate overnight and bake in the morning for stress-free breakfast or brunch.

PREP TIME: 15 minutes
RESTING TIME: 4 hours
COOK TIME: 45 minutes
SERVINGS: 8-12
TOTAL TIME: 5 hours
Ingredients
1 (1-pound) French bread loaf (day-old bread preferred)
9 large eggs
2 cups whole milk
1 cup half and half
½ cup sugar
1 Tbsp vanilla extract
1½ tsp ground cinnamon
1 tsp salt
1 cup sliced strawberries

Instructions
Tear bread into small, bite-sized pieces and place in a greased 9 x 13-inch baking dish.
In a medium bowl, combine eggs, milk, half and half, sugar, vanilla, cinnamon and salt. Whisk until combined. Pour egg mixture evenly over bread, stir gently to ensure bread is coated. cover. Refrigerate 4 hours or up to overnight.
When ready to eat:
Preheat oven to 350°F.
Top with strawberries and bake 45 minutes until cooked through, puffed and lightly golden. Serve with maple syrup, powdered sugar and fresh berries, if desired.
